Benchmark indices opened on a negative note on Wednesday, as Asian markets dropped following a sharp fall seen in US stocks overnight.
At 9.22 am, the BSE Sensex was trading 160 points, or 0.50 per cent lower at 31,649.
Nifty50 was trading 60.05 points, or 0.60 per cent, lower at 9,892.15.
"We continue to expect index consolidating in a range of 9,855-10,000 for a while; but, during this, lot of individual stocks are likely to outperform. In such kind of scenarios, traders are advised not to participate in index specific trades; rather keep concentrating on selective mid caps that are showing excellent buying interest," Angel Broking said in a note.
